In a previous report, we analyzed the stomach contents of juvenile chum salmon Oncorhynchus keta by morphological observation and also by molecular identification using the mitochondrial cytochrome c oxidase subunit I (COI) region. However, one of the most frequently detected COI sequences could not be assigned to any specific taxon, even at the phylum level. In the present study, we conducted in situ hybridization (ISH) on the stomach contents of juvenile chum salmon using the COI sequence and polymerase chain reaction amplification of a 18S ribosomal RNA gene from the tissue sections where ISH signals were detected. As a result, the organism that was enigmatic at the phylum level was found to be an appendicularian. Moreover, Oikopleura longicauda collected from the bay where the juvenile chum salmon samples were obtained was shown to have the same COI sequences as this taxonomic “orphan” COI sequence from the stomach contents. The present results suggest that the COI sequences previously deposited in public databases for “Oikopleura” are actually derived from taxonomic groups other than appendicularians, and that this may have hampered our understanding of prey richness in the stomach or gut of certain marine animals based on DNA barcoding. 相似文献

The growth performance and stress response in striped knifejaw, Oplegnathus fasciatus (body weight 100–300 g) reared under four photoperiods (6L:6D, 12L:12D, 16L:8D and 24L:0D) were investigated. Fish were fed a commercial diet to apparent satiation, two times a day for 8 weeks. A trial of acute handling and confinement stress was also carried out to investigate the stress-induced levels of different stress indicators in O. fasciatus. Blood was also collected from undisturbed fish which was considered as control. Although there were no significant differences in weight gain, specific growth rate (SGR) and feed conversion efficiency (FCE) in fish exposed to 6L:6D, 16L:8D and 24L:0D photoperiods, all parameters in these photoperiods were significantly higher than those of 12L:12D photoperiod (P < 0.05). There was no significant difference in protein retention efficiency (PRE) between fish exposed to 16L:8D and 24L:0D photoperiods, but PRE in both photoperiods was significantly higher than that of 12L:12D photoperiod.Acute stress significantly increased the plasma levels of cortisol (110.3 ng ml− 1) and glucose (195.4 mg dl− 1), and decreased plasma levels of total protein (0.8 g dl− 1); however, all parameters were returned back to the levels indistinguishable from those of control, undisturbed fish within 24 h. The levels of cortisol, glucose and total protein in fish exposed to different photoperiods during the study were far from the stress-induced levels (P < 0.05). The results demonstrated that the growth performance of O. fasciatus reared from 100 to 300 g can be stimulated significantly by using the manipulated photoperiods where feeding time may be playing an important role to increase food intake and feed conversion efficiency. It also revealed that the artificial photoperiods did not cause significant stress response in fish. 相似文献

This study was conducted to evaluate the performance of Sugi lamina impregnated with low-molecular weight phenolic (LMWP) resin using the full cell process followed by curing at high temperature. In this study, penetration of LMWP resin into finger-jointed lamina was examined. Physical and mechanical properties, such as surface hardness, dimensional stability, bending and shear strength of LMWP-resin-treated and untreated lamina were investigated. In addition, the bonding quality and nail-withdrawal resistance of 3-ply assembly specimen made from LMWP-resin-treated and untreated lamina bonded using resorcinol–phenol formaldehyde resin adhesive were also investigated. The main results were as follows: LMWP resin was found to have penetrated sufficiently into finger-jointed lamina. The physical properties of LMWP-resin-treated lamina were found to have improved significantly in comparison with untreated lamina. However, no significant difference was found between LMWP-resin-treated and untreated lamina in terms of their mechanical properties. There was an improvement in bonding quality of the assembly made from LMWP-resin-treated lamina when compared with that made from untreated lamina. In the assembly made from untreated lamina, a significant decrease in nail-withdrawal resistance was observed between dry conditions test and after humidity conditioning test. However, the same tendency was not found in the assembly made from LMWP-resin-treated lamina. 相似文献

Bacterial fruit blotch of cucurbits is a destructive disease caused by Acidovorax avenae subsp. citrulli, which is a typical seedborne pathogen. In seed health testing for this disease, we have detected many strains of Acidovorax with some differences from A. avenae subsp. citrulli. Their 16S rRNA sequences were divided into six types. The most common sequence was completely consistent with that of A. avenae subsp. avenae originally isolated from rice. The other sequences were over 99% similar but not identical to those of A. avenae subsp. avenae and A. avenae subsp. citrulli. Some commercialized antibodies against A. avenae subsp. citrulli reacted with several of these strains. Some of these strains incited yellow spots or brownish water-soaked lesions mainly
on young true leaves of cucumber and squash after spray inoculation. Histological observations showed that these strains entered
the leaf tissues of cucurbit plants through stomata and multiplied in the intercellular spaces of parenchymatous tissues as
well as in the vascular tissues. The amount of bacterial multiplication and spread in the tissues differed among the strains,
presumably reflecting their ability to induce symptoms. These isolated strains are therefore different from A. avenae subsp. citrulli, and their potential threat to the cultivation of cucurbits is lower than that of A. avenae subsp. citrulli. 相似文献

Quality food for human consumption will always be the aim for animal producers. Quantity and composition of fat deposits (fatty acid profile) strongly influences meat quality in ruminants, especially via increasing conjugated linoleic acid (CLA) concentration, which is known to have beneficial anticarcinogenic, antiatherogenic, antidiabetic and cholesterol reduction properties for human health. Awassi lambs are one of the main and most consumed meat sources in the Middle East area; however, studies addressing the fat content of CLA and methods to enhance its concentrations in this breed are still rare. For this reason, the aim of this study was to evaluate the effect of adding two different oil sources (soybean oil (SBO) and sunflower oil (SFO) at two levels (1.8 and 3%)) on growth performance, carcass characteristics and fatty acid profile of fat in Awassi lambs. Oil supplementation had no effect on growth performance or carcass characteristics, while fatty acid composition changed according to the site of extraction. CLA concentrations were increased in the tail fat deposit, with 1.8% SBO and in intermuscular fat deposit with 3% SFO. Intermuscular fat is the one most naturally consumed by humans, serving to improve food quality. 相似文献

ABSTRACT: This study examined age and growth of Japanese flounder Paralichthys olivaceus off the Pacific coast of northern Japan, and determined whether the growth patterns of male and female fish in northern (40–41°N) and southern (37–38°15'N) waters differ. In total 8095 specimens were collected between January 1999 and December 2005. Zonation consisting of opaque and translucent bands on the otolith was evident. Within each opaque band a thin and clear check (ring mark) was observed in all specimens examined. Monthly change in the frequency of appearance of a ring mark on the outer margin of the otolith indicates that ring marks form between July and August. The von Bertalanffy growth model showed a sexual dimorphism in growth, as females grew faster and reached a larger size than males. The growth patterns obtained by tracking the observed total length for monthly collections showed a rapid increase in total length between August and October. Spatial variation in the growth pattern of male and female fish between northern and southern waters was evident, as southern fish were significantly larger than northern counterparts during 1.25–3.00 years post hatch. 相似文献

The biomass distribution, community structure and species composition of the dominant micronektonic animals were determined in the western tropical Pacific, using day/night sampling from upper 200 m depth with a commercial midwater otter trawl in fall‐winter of 1994, 1995 and 1997. Night‐time micronekton biomass was significantly higher than daytime biomass except for a few cases. All the night‐time catches had similar taxonomic composition, dominated by myctophid fishes, small squids, shrimps and euphausiids. Night‐time micronekton biomass in the upper 200 m was assumed to be higher in the North Equatorial Counter Current than in the North Equatorial Current, reflecting the zooplankton biomass distribution which micronektons feed on at night. A total of 42 species of myctophid fishes, 34 species of squids, 27 species of shrimps and six species of euphausiids were collected. Community types of each dominant taxonomic group were classified by cluster analysis based on the species composition. A station located north of the subtropical convergence zone was distinct from other tropical stations south of the convergence zone, having significantly different species composition in three of the four dominant taxonomic groups (myctophids, squids and shrimps). The interaction between the larvae of commercially important fishes and micronektonic animals is discussed. 相似文献

A 14-year-old intact male Maltese dog was presented with a history of pain and swelling of the left upper forelimb and lameness for 3 weeks. Hematological and radiographical examinations showed regenerative anemia and osteolysis of the humerus. Fine needle aspiration biopsy detected epithelioid- and fibroblast-like anaplastic cells with blood components. A hemorrhagic and osteolytic malignant tumor was suspected, and the affected forelimb was amputated. Histopathologically, the dog was diagnosed with primary hemangiosarcoma of the humerus. Thereafter, metastatic lesions appeared in the skin, and the dog was euthanized 1 month after the operation. 相似文献
